    Spontaneity may be observed in following conditions
    Solution
    When the process is exothermic $$ (\triangle H _{system} < 0 ),$$
    and the entropy of the system increases
    ($$ \triangle $$ system $$  > 0), \triangle G $$ will be negative at
    all temperatures. Thus, the process is always
     spontaneous.
